With exports cratering and escalating uncertainty for businesses and consumers, the Canada–United States trade war has caused a widespread “fall off in momentum” across several touchpoints in Canada’s economy, according to the author of a new report.

“If I had to underline one common theme, it’s obviously uncertainty and what businesses and households are doing to mitigate those challenges posed by uncertainty,” said Guy Gellatly, chief economic advisor at Statistics Canada, about the report that highlights key economic developments since the start of the year.
